I am a frequent business traveler, flying to and from major East Coast cities. On my last flight back from Atlanta, my trusty, old "business guy black carry on" finally bit the dust. Duct taped handle, zippers closed with safety pins don't really scream successful-and-savvy- business-woman anyway. So it was time for something new. After doing a great deal of research on the web, I decided to give Briggs and Riley a try. They have an amazing online fanbase! Next I researched the various carry on designs that they offer and decided to give the Transcend Wide Body Spinner a go. It arrived on my porch today. What a well made piece of luggage! I immediately did a pretend pack for my next trip and my two days of clothing, including workout attire, two pairs of shoes, business casual clothing, laptop, leather folio, phone charger...it all fit in there with room to spare. I may have to rethink my pack list, because maybe I do have room for a third change of clothes and another pair of shoes. The zippers and other closures feel solid and sturdy. The spinner base spins like a troupe of well seasoned ballerinas. The handle, which attaches on the outside of the bag, feels strong and stable. And there is a small pouch attached between where the handles connect that I think will be a perfect place to store my laptop charger brick and cord. I got the rainforest green, just to not have another black bag. It is a very dark green, actually more of a brown green. But it's not another boring black business bag, so I'm happy. This is a pricey piece of luggage and I would not recommend it to someone who only flies for vacations, because it is really too small for that. But for the business traveler who goes on 1-3 day trips, this bag should fit the bill nicely.

After two trips, I can confirm that this little guy holds more than any of the traditional carry-ons I've used before. One reason is that the bars for the extended handle are mounted on the outside of the case, leaving more efficient packing room inside. (In between the handles there's space to tuck in chargers or travel umbrellas.) Together with a tote bag, I have enough room for a three- to five-day trip. The wheels make it easy to push the bag alongside vs. dragging it behind you. Because it's shorter, the bag takes up less space in overhead bins (no need to put it in sideways in most). I've had other bags from Briggs & Riley and have been very impressed with their quality and clever features.

My job requires a lot of travel, so I need a bag that can withstand the rigors of regional and large body jets, and the various moods of baggage handlers. When my B&R bag arrived, I was worried that it was too small. So I did a "practice pack" with a week's worth of clothes/shoes/toiletries with my packing cubes and compression bags. I was shocked that I easily fit my slacks, shoes, blouses, robe and toiletries in the bag, and I had room for another pair of shoes! The B&R bag rolls like a breeze through airports, and its color is easy to spot at baggage claim. Add in the lifetime warranty, and this bag is a winner. Don't let the price scare you off. It's a terrific bag.

This is a great small carry-on bag. It holds about 2 full packing cubes and 2 quarter cubes. The zipper compartment on the very front is not very useful; it could hold paperwork or magazines. The main front compartment is fairly shallow, good to stash a very light-weight jacket. The I love my Briggs and Riley luggage, so it was an easy decision to stick with the brand.

Best suitcase ever. Paired this with the Briggs & Riley Transcend Rolling Cabin Bag and fit everything I needed for a five-night stay in Europe. With these two as my only luggage, I didn't need to check a bag. The spinner wheels make it easy to roll down the airplane aisle without bumping anyone's seat. Fits perfectly into the overhead compartment unless you pack something too bulky in the outside pocket.

Well made bag, but unfortunately, I had to return it. The bag dimensions don't include the wheels. If you are planning to purchase the bag for us on international carriers with very strict carry-on requirements (EasyJet/Ryanair), this bag is too large. It measures 22" tall with the wheels.
